Episode 8: PCOS: Misdiagnosed, Misunderstood, and More Than Just a Period Problem

Polycystic Ovary Syndrome (PCOS) is one of the most common yet misunderstood hormonal conditions in women — and chances are, if you’ve been diagnosed, misdiagnosed, or dismissed altogether… you’re not alone.

In this episode, I break down:

  • What PCOS actually is — and what it isn’t
  • How the diagnosis is made
  • Why insulin resistance is the most under-addressed root cause
  • What your LH:FSH ratio and progesterone levels reveal
  • The real risks of untreated PCOS: metabolic syndrome, NAFLD, heart disease, and more
  • Why birth control can help symptoms but doesn’t fix the root
  • How to approach treatment beyond prescriptions — and build a real plan
  • And yes — why you can have PCOS even if your labs are “normal”
